Output e86c9f171c1f26a3812ffa9da202cfdfdde671c2e4101a18e7838373dd1d2306:1

value
55000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82a50f6c52f2b1a788eaaa98170f08d960dd80a OP_EQUAL
address
3QKCCJYmaq6mBfwZk6S56Cu281KTap3HJY
transaction
e86c9f171c1f26a3812ffa9da202cfdfdde671c2e4101a18e7838373dd1d2306
confirmations
221588
spent
true